About JA Platt
JA Platt is a scholar working on Orthodontics, Oral Surgery, General Dentistry, Radiology, Nuclear Medicine and Imaging and Organic Chemistry, having authored 13 papers that have together received 706 indexed citations. Recurring topics across this work include Dental materials and restorations (13 papers), Endodontics and Root Canal Treatments (6 papers), Dental Research and COVID-19 (5 papers), Dental Implant Techniques and Outcomes (4 papers), Orthodontics and Dentofacial Orthopedics (3 papers), Dental Erosion and Treatment (3 papers), Laser Applications in Dentistry and Medicine (2 papers) and Photopolymerization techniques and applications (1 paper). The work is most often cited by research in Orthodontics (668 citations), General Dentistry (203 citations), Oral Surgery (458 citations), Emergency Medical Services (39 citations) and Complementary and Manual Therapy (9 citations). JA Platt has collaborated with scholars based in United States, United Arab Emirates and Saudi Arabia. Frequent co-authors include Hatem M. El‐Damanhoury, L. Correr‐Sobrinho, Gilberto Antônio Borges, Marco C. Bottino, Afnan O. Al‐Zain, G.J. Eckert, Alexandre Luiz Souto Borges, Ghaeth H. Yassen, Jadesada Palasuk and B Rhodes. Their work appears in journals such as Operative Dentistry and PubMed.
